Divrey Hayamim Bais 3:9-17 Orthodox Jewish Bible (OJB)

9. And the weight of the masmerot (nails) was fifty shekels of zahav. And he overlaid the upper rooms with zahav.

10. And in the Bais Kodesh HaKadashim he made two keruvim of ma'aseh tza'atzu'im (sculpture work), and overlaid them with zahav.

11. And the wings of the keruvim were twenty cubits long; one wing of the one keruv was five cubits, reaching to the wall of the Bais; and the other wing was likewise five cubits, reaching to the wing of the other keruv.

12. And one wing of the other keruv was five cubits, reaching to the wall of the Bais; and the other wing was five cubits also, joining to the wing of the other keruv.

13. The wings of these keruvim spread themselves forth twenty cubits; and they stood on their feet, and their faces turned inward.

14. And he made the Parochet of blue wool, and purple, and crimson, and fine linen, and wrought keruvim thereon.

15. Also he made before the Bais two [freestanding] Ammudim (pillars) of thirty and five cubits high [53 feet], and the capital that was on the top of each of them was five cubits.

16. And he made sharsherot in the Devir, and put them on the rosh of the Ammudim; and made a hundred pomegranates, and put them on the sharsherot.

17. And he erected the Ammudim before the Heikhal, one on the right, and the other on the left; and called the shem of that on the right Yachin, and the shem of that on the left Boaz.
